tbh i dont think a board game needs the basing. i guess it could but i kinda think it fits the theme better no?


I agree, I think the bases are fine left as simple black plastic.

The game board is fairly ornate with varying colors splashed across it, so even doing a color themed base trying to match the game board might not look right. As jarring as "unfinished" bases look to this wargamer, I think they work fine for this type of product.
